Genesis 44:20-29 New Century Version (NCV)

20. And we answered you, ‘We have an old father. And we have a younger brother, who was born when our father was old. This youngest son’s brother is dead, so he is the only one of his mother’s children left alive, and our father loves him very much.’

21. Then you said to us, ‘Bring that brother to me. I want to see him.’

22. And we said to you, ‘That young boy cannot leave his father, because if he leaves him, his father would die.’

23. But you said to us, ‘If you don’t bring your youngest brother, you will not be allowed to see me again.’

24. So we went back to our father and told him what you had said.

25. “Later, our father said, ‘Go again and buy us a little more food.’

26. We said to our father, ‘We cannot go without our youngest brother. Without our youngest brother, we will not be allowed to see the governor.’

27. Then my father said to us, ‘You know that my wife Rachel gave me two sons.

28. When one son left me, I thought, “Surely he has been torn apart by a wild animal,” and I haven’t seen him since.

29. Now you want to take this son away from me also. But something terrible might happen to him, and I would be miserable until the day I die.’
